Hipotronics TDR1170 — The unique features and

new technology used in the TDR 1170 make it the
most flexible and easiest to use instrument available
for advanced cable fault location. The TDR 1170
features an automatic configuration, which can be
modified as necessary. All cable fault data can be
stored and retrieved at any time, ensuring time
savings, consistency and accuracy from one crew to
the next.

The digital TDR 1170 will locate and identify short
circuit (bolted) faults, low resistance shunt faults, open
circuits, high resistance series faults, wet sections,
splices, transformers, cable transitions, and concentric
neutral corrosion. To locate high resistance,
intermittent and flashover faults, the TDR 1170 is
designed to measure in the digital arc reflection,
current impulse, voltage decay, and all differential fault
locating modes. The selection of fault location method
allows the operator to select the method which they
are most familiar with or the method that is most
appropriate for the type of cable and type of fault that
is encountered.

The TDR 1170 requires a high voltage coupler to
interface to a cable fault locator (thumper). The cable
fault locator then provides the voltage and current to
enable the TDR 1170 to quickly and definitively locate
cable faults.

Included with the TDR 1170 is a software package to
allow the stored data to be viewed on a PC and also be
printed and analyzed by office personnel or training
teams.
